Overview
Senior Technical Lead - Frontend / UI role at Capital Technology Group is a client-facing leadership position focused on frontend development and UI. The role supports high-impact federal programs, shaping technical approaches, providing mentorship, and aligning design and development practices with client expectations and operational goals. This role requires US citizenship and the ability to obtain Public Trust clearance.
Responsibilities
- Lead a frontend development team, providing technical guidance, mentoring, and direction to less senior developers and designers.
- Serve as a client-facing technical lead, articulating design and technical decisions to stakeholders and collaborating closely with clients.
- Drive the technical approach and implementation strategy for the program's frontend systems and interfaces.
- Collaborate with a UI team to ensure solutions are intuitive, accessible, and aligned with best practices in human-centered design.
- Develop, create, and modify frontend applications and specialized utility programs using JavaScript, TypeScript, ReactJS, and related frameworks.
- Analyze user needs and develop software solutions that optimize operational efficiency.
- Work with backend developers to integrate frontend systems with databases and services (MySQL, PostgreSQL, APIs).
- Participate in code reviews, ensure quality standards, and promote best practices for frontend development.
- Stay current with emerging technologies, frameworks, and industry trends to inform technical and design decisions.
- Support DevOps practices and collaborate with cross-functional teams on CI / CD, testing, and deployment as needed.
